The Joke was a vast system of graft and protection involving illegal gambling, starting price bookmakers, brothels and massage parlours that stretched back decades in Queensland. In 1992, it found himguilty of corruptionfor appointing renegade Liberal MP Terry Metherell to a senior public service position to allow the government to regain his safe seat. Of the 35 corruption issue investigations finalised during the year, 10 corruption findings were made by Aclei, while agencies finalised 104 corruption investigations. Because Aclei is required to prioritise the most serious corruption offences, it investigated just 108 of the issues, while 306 were referred back to enforcement agencies for investigation and action.
